Output 6b384f1caee00f08ede42f0c27a7dfd33d7432441ee64b09eb4c53bb8b4b3858:4

value
41770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52fa26479ad5b0245ae98ca5c1192080380f619d OP_EQUAL
address
39Fkzy6HJcXC2UdPAzbJhtsLaNqqBykpQF
transaction
6b384f1caee00f08ede42f0c27a7dfd33d7432441ee64b09eb4c53bb8b4b3858
confirmations
196404
spent
true